Manjhiathagaon

Manjhiathagaon is a village located in Farasgaon tehsil of Bastar district in Chhattisgarh, India. It is situated 6km away from sub-district headquarter Farasgaon (tehsildar office) and 107km away from district headquarter Jagdalpur. As per 2009 stats, Manjhiaatgaon is the gram panchayat of Manjhiathagaon village.

About Manjhiathagaon

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Manjhiathagaon is 448935. The village spans a total geographical area of 847 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 494228. Farasgaon is nearest town to Manjhiathagaon village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 6km away.

Population of Manjhiathagaon

Below is a concise population overview of Manjhiathagaon as per the Census 2011 data. The table highlights the key population metrics categorized by gender and social groups.

ParticularsTotalMaleFemale
Total Population 1,623 759 864
Child Population (0–6 yrs) 253 116 137
Scheduled Castes (SC) 53 27 26
Scheduled Tribes (ST) 1,307 610 697
Literate Population 710 405 305
Illiterate Population 913 354 559

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Manjhiathagaon village:

  • The total population of Manjhiathagaon village is around 1,623, including approximately 759 males and 864 females, with a sex ratio of 1138 females per 1,000 males.
  • There are about 253 children aged 0–6 years in Manjhiathagaon village, reflecting the young population in the village.
  • Manjhiathagaon village has 53 people belonging to the Scheduled Castes (SC) and 1,307 residents from the Scheduled Tribes (ST).
  • The literacy rate of Manjhiathagaon village is about 43.75%, with male literacy at 53.36% and female literacy at 35.30%.
  • There are around 349 households in Manjhiathagaon village.

Connectivity of Manjhiathagaon

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Manjhiathagaon. As per the 2011 stats, Manjhiathagaon had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available
Private Bus Service Available within village
Railway Station Available within 10+ km distance
